Back-to-School: Teacher’s Card

Boy, the summer sure is flying by.  Before you know it, all the little ones will be heading back to the classroom and all their new teachers. Perhaps your child would like to start the year off right with a gift for the teacher. Here is my idea of a card that could go along with your gift.

Materials Used:

  • Image – Saturated Canary – Hillary
  • Cardstock – Express It Blending Card and Stampin Up Buckaroo Blue
  • Pattern Paper – Recollections – Back to School
  • Ribbon – 3/8″ Red Satin and 1/8″ Red Satin
  • Punches – Stampin Up Ticket Punch; Photo Corner Punch
  • Copic Markers
  • Adhesive – Double-sided tape; Zots small
  • Mini Bowdabra
  • Hair Bow Tool & Ruler

 

Instructions:

1.  Begin by placing the Hair Bow Tool & Ruler onto the Mini Bowdabra.  Cut 12″ piece of 1/8″ red ribbon and place it into the Mini Bowdabra.

2.  Place your satin ribbon into the Mini Bowdabra with the tail on the left at the 2″ mark and the wrong side of the ribbon facing towards you.

3.  Fold the ribbon on the right side at the 1 1/4″ mark and take it over to the left side.  As you do this, twist the ribbon in the center so that the shiny/right side of the ribbon is facing up on the right side, and the wrong side of the ribbon is facing up on the left side.

4.  Fold the ribbon on the left at the 1 1/4″ mark and take it back through the Mini Bowdabra to the right side of the Mini Bowdabra again twisting the ribbon in the middle so that the shiny right side is facing up on the left and the wrong side is facing up on the right.

5.  Gently pull up the ends of the 1/8″ ribbons and tie a knot on the back of the bow.

6.  Carefully trim the ends of the 1/8″ ribbon and the 1/2″ ribbon tails.

7.  To finish off you bow, take a 1/2″ glue dot attach it to the back of your bow.

8.  Attach bow to card and you’re done!
